Excel SUM 公式指南
介绍
Microsoft Excel 是一种处理数据的通用工具,SUM 公式是其最基本但最强大的功能之一。Aspose.Cells for Java 将 Excel 操作提升到一个新的水平,使您能够轻松自动执行任务、生成报告和执行复杂的计算。本指南将帮助您使用 Aspose.Cells 充分发挥 SUM 公式的潜力。
什么是 Aspose.Cells for Java?
Aspose.Cells for Java 是一个强大的 Java API,可让开发人员以编程方式处理 Excel 电子表格。它提供了创建、操作和分析 Excel 文件的各种功能,使其成为企业和使用数据驱动应用程序的开发人员不可或缺的工具。
设置环境
在深入研究 Excel 公式之前,设置开发环境至关重要。确保已安装 Java,下载 Aspose.Cells for Java 库,并将其包含在项目中。您可以找到下载链接这里.
创建新工作簿
让我们首先使用 Aspose.Cells for Java 创建一个新的 Excel 工作簿。以下是帮助您入门的基本代码片段:
//初始化新工作簿
Workbook workbook = new Workbook();
//添加工作表
Worksheet worksheet = workbook.getWorksheets().get(0);
//保存工作簿
workbook.save("sample.xlsx");
此代码设置一个新的工作簿并将其保存为“sample.xlsx”。
向工作表添加数据
现在我们有了工作簿,我们需要向其中添加一些数据。以下是向工作表中的单元格添加数字的方法:
//访问单元格并添加数据
Cell cell = worksheet.getCells().get("A1");
cell.putValue(10);
//保存工作簿
workbook.save("sample.xlsx");
在此示例中,我们将数字 10 添加到单元格 A1。
理解 SUM 公式
SUM 公式用于在 Excel 中计算一系列数字的总和。其基本语法是=SUM(range)
其中“范围”代表要加在一起的单元格。
使用 Aspose.Cells 的 SUM 功能
Aspose.Cells 简化了 SUM 公式的实现。以下是使用方法:
//对某个范围内的值求和
Cell sumCell = worksheet.getCells().get("B1");
sumCell.setFormula("=SUM(A1:A10)");
//计算并保存工作簿
workbook.calculateFormula();
workbook.save("sample.xlsx");
在此示例中,我们使用了setFormula
方法将 SUM 公式应用于单元格 B1,对单元格 A1 至 A10 中的值求和。
在不同范围应用 SUM
您还可以将 SUM 公式应用于工作表中的多个范围。例如,如果您想要分别添加不同列或行中的数据,则可以这样做:
//对两个不同范围求和
Cell sumCell1 = worksheet.getCells().get("B1");
sumCell1.setFormula("=SUM(A1:A10)");
Cell sumCell2 = worksheet.getCells().get("C1");
sumCell2.setFormula("=SUM(D1:D10)");
//计算并保存工作簿
workbook.calculateFormula();
workbook.save("sample.xlsx");
在这里,我们计算了单元格 A1 到 A10 和 D1 到 D10 中的值的总和,并将结果分别放在单元格 B1 和 C1 中。
使用 Aspose.Cells 进行条件求和
Aspose.Cells 还允许您实现条件 SUM 公式,这对于复杂的数据分析非常有用。您可以使用以下函数SUMIF
和SUMIFS
对您的总数应用条件。
//条件总和
Cell sumCell = worksheet.getCells().get("B1");
sumCell.setFormula("=SUMIF(A1:A10, \">5\")");
//计算并保存工作簿
workbook.calculateFormula();
workbook.save("sample.xlsx");
在此示例中,我们对单元格 A1 到 A10 中的值求和,但仅包括大于 5 的数字。
处理错误和边缘情况
使用 Excel 公式时,处理错误和极端情况至关重要。Aspose.Cells 提供强大的错误处理功能,确保您的计算准确可靠。请务必探索这些功能,以有效处理各种情况。
格式化 SUM 结果
呈现数据时,格式化至关重要。Aspose.Cells 提供广泛的格式化选项,让您的 SUM 结果更具视觉吸引力。您可以自定义字体、颜色、边框等,以创建具有专业外观的电子表格。
结论
在本综合指南中,我们探讨了 Excel SUM 公式以及如何使用 Aspose.Cells for Java 来利用它。您已经了解了如何设置环境、创建工作簿、添加数据以及在各种情况下应用 SUM 公式。有了这些知识,您可以简化 Excel 自动化任务并充分发挥 Aspose.Cells 的潜力。
常见问题解答
如何下载 Aspose.Cells for Java?
您可以从以下网站下载 Aspose.Cells for Java:这里选择适合您需求的版本并按照安装说明进行操作。
我可以在商业项目中使用 Aspose.Cells for Java 吗?
是的,Aspose.Cells for Java 适用于商业和非商业项目。它提供满足各种需求(包括企业需求)的许可选项。
Aspose.Cells 中的 SUM 公式有什么限制吗?
Aspose.Cells 为 Excel 公式(包括 SUM)提供强大的支持。但是,务必查看文档并测试您的具体用例,以确保兼容性和性能。
我可以使用 Aspose.Cells 自动执行其他 Excel 功能吗?
当然!Aspose.Cells for Java 支持多种 Excel 函数,使其成为自动执行各种任务(包括计算、数据提取和格式化)的多功能工具。
在哪里可以找到有关 Aspose.Cells for Java 的更多资源和文档?
您可以在以下位置访问 Aspose.Cells for Java 的全面文档和其他资源这里浏览文档以发现高级功能和示例。